Direct route From Calais
over France
Calais. Get
on Road and drive east towards Arras/Dunkerque/Lille/Paris/Reims/St.Omer
to A26 / E17 towards Châlons/Troyes
A5/E17
towards Chaumont/Dijon-Lyon/Magnant/Mulhouse.
A31 towards Langres-Nord/Metz-Nancy/Vesoul.
Take
directions Besançon/Neuchâtel A5 towards
Bern/Biel/Bienne/Lausanne/Neuchâtel-Maladière.
Onto A1/E25/E27 towards Bern/Interlaken. A6 towards Bern-Ostring/Interlaken/Thun.
A8 towards Interlaken/Brienz/Gotthard/Iseltwald/Meiringen/Innertkirchen
Direction Grimsel-SustenPass
890 Kms - 556 miles
Route Over France/Belgium/Luxembourg
Calais - Get on road and keep left towards Arras/Dunkerque/Lille/Paris/Reims/St
Omer.
Take exit 28 to the right towards A25/Bergues/Lille/Ypres.
Keep right onto A1 towards A22/Aéroport de Lille-Lesquin/Bruxelles/Gent (Gand).
Take the E411 ramp to the right towards Bruxelles/Luxembourg/Namur.
Take the E25 ramp to the right towards Luxembourg/Metz/Saarbrücken.
Take the A3 ramp to the left towards Belgique/Deutschland/Luxembourg.
Take the A4/E25/E50 ramp to the left towards Metz-Est/Sarrebruck/Strasbourg.
Keep left onto A35/E25 towards Mulhouse/Offenburg/St Dié-Colmar/Strasbourg.
Keep left onto A35/E25 towards Aéroport/Mulhouse/St Dié-Colmar.
A35 towards Colmar/Mulhouse/Obernai/Saint-Dié-Des-Vosges
Par Tunnel.
Take the A5 ramp to the right
towards Basel/Lörrach.
Keep left onto A2/A3/E25/E35/E60 towards Basel-Bern.
Keep right onto A1/E25 towards Bern/Biel/Lausanne.
Keep left onto A6 towards Bern//Interlaken/Thun.
Keep left onto A8 towards Interlaken/Luzern.
Keep left onto A8 towards Brienz/Gotthard/Iseltwald/Luzern/Meiringen/Innertkirchen.
Direction Susten-Grimsel Pass.
967 Kms - 604 miles

Phil & Andy Suggest that if you are going over Dijon or Geneva
then
Dijon in FORMULA 1 - Cost approx 27 Euros
FORMULA 1
Beaune
just south of Dijon
A very picturesque city in the Burgundy wine region.
Andy's recommendation is not stopping in one of the numerous hotels just off the
motorway in what looks like an industrial park
for hotels, but to continue
to the city centre and use one of the many hotels there,
although dearer
the city is worth a visit and he spent many a pleasant evening there.
